Post Office Building, Kalamazoo, Michigan, during demolition
Description:
Black-and-white photograph of a red brick Post Office Building, Kalamazoo, Michigan located at southwest corner of South Burdick Street and West South Street. Completed in 1892, it was used into the 1930s and later demolished in 1940. View is looking southwest showing portion of building without roof and without glass in the windows. Also shows a portion of the Michigan Bell Telephone Building next door.
